Output 308d84a4d5ee3705c0a7cc625b774f8860d003e7185d4a2631fdb21d9b74c522:59
- value
- 1644219
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dddf8e0da32acfd5ec145976b654cb26b9fa7150 OP_EQUAL
- address
- 3MvB4odNSfVdEZ5ZiinAMRfU9JMLxv5XnR
- transaction
- 308d84a4d5ee3705c0a7cc625b774f8860d003e7185d4a2631fdb21d9b74c522